Pantheons are all the gods of the land
considered collectively.
Some Ghanaian traditions give some godly
regards to chiefs. That is why our editor
decided to refer to all united chiefs as pantheons.
The durbar at Antwerp under the call of Nana Okotwerebour
Ampadu, chief of Kwahu's in Belgium, was to help him celebrate the life
of his father-in-law who has departed for eternity. It was a meeting of
Pantheons and Champions because all the chiefs and dignataries were
present including diplomats accredited to the Kingdom of Belgium and
the European Union.
Nana Opuni Dua Ware 1 who was made Abusuapanin for the
occasion remembered the Blackstars in his speech. He wished
them the best of luck. All Ghanaians present cheered that up.
A special traditional song request was made for them and all
the pantheons danced to the tune.
